Default spring install question

So I went to a shop to do a spring install because was to scared to do it my self. So as . I was watching them do the install I can't tell if they messed up or not and I am paranoid. So what is the worse case scenario for spring install to go wrong? And the shop went to did not torque the bolts but they did use impact guns should i be concerned?

Worst case: all your suspension arms fall off and springs shoot out, making you crash and die in a fiery inferno.




but that probably won't happen.

sounds like a quality shop doing the install (sarcasm). If they just impact all the nuts on, they are probably all over tightened and will be a ***** to get off someday. They probably didn't load the suspension when tightening everything down so your car could behave funny or your alignment could change over time.

But you'll be fine...lots of shops work this way and the car turns out fine. But it's the reason why I do all my own work. No one cares about your car more than you do.
